Job description

Day Camp Junior Counselor

This position supports the work of the YMCA, a leading nonprofit organization committed to strengthening community through youth development, healthy living, and social responsibility. The Day Camp Junior Counselor provides direct supervision of children in a seasonal day camp program and creates positive, nurturing relationships with campers while building cooperative relationships with parents and caregivers. The role promotes the potential of all youth and encourages peer-to-peer connections as part of the overall camp experience.

Essential Functions
  • Keep campers focused and engaged in camp activities.
  • Assist Specialists during activity periods.
  • Greet campers consistently with enthusiasm and positivity.
  • Develop positive relationships with member families and understand their connection to the YMCA.
  • Learn campers’ names and respond to camper needs.
  • Assist the Senior Counselor, Specialists, and all camp staff in implementing themes, special events, trips, and daily activities.
  • Encourage campers’ youth development and personal growth.
  • Help maintain cleanliness within the camp group.
  • Work cooperatively with all camp staff when planning and carrying out activities.
  • Perform all responsibilities with enthusiasm and commitment, treating campers and staff with respect and care.
  • Use redirection and positive reinforcement to promote appropriate behavior and good choices.
  • Teach and model the YMCA’s Four Core Values: Caring, Respect, Honesty, and Responsibility.
  • Perform additional duties as requested by the supervisor.
Safety Responsibilities
  • Attend regular staff meetings scheduled by the supervisor.
  • Complete all required trainings.
  • Uphold camp safety standards at all times, including maintaining constant camper counts.
  • Understand and follow risk management and emergency policies and procedures.
  • Assist with group control and lunchtime activities.
  • Follow all Association Aquatics Policy Guidelines.
  • Carry out assigned aquatic responsibilities and assist with safe, efficient pool transitions.
  • Follow all YMCA, ACA, and NJ Licensing standards to ensure camper safety and program quality.
  • Complete and submit all accident reports.
  • Report immediate concerns to the Camp Director or nearest supervisor.
  • Assist with bus supervision, ensuring safety, efficiency, and engagement through songs, stories, and games.
